Job Description

Salary: £50,908 - £53,051 per annum

Hours: 37 hours per week

Interview Date: Thursday 08 and Friday 09 October 2026

Are you looking to step away from frontline legal practice and use your expertise to shape how legal services are delivered?
This is an exciting opportunity for an experienced lawyer, legal professional or business improvement specialist who wants to move beyond managing a caseload and play a key role in driving service improvement, performance and change.

As a member of the Legal Leadership Team, you will help shape how Legal Services supports the council's priorities. Rather than undertaking fee-earning work or managing a legal caseload, you will focus on improving how the service operates, using data, insight and analysis to identify opportunities, manage demand and support strategic decision-making.

Working closely with senior leaders and services across the council, you will build strong relationships, develop a deep understanding of organisational priorities and help Legal Services and service areas work more effectively together. Using excellent communication and influencing skills, you will translate complex information into clear, practical messages, challenge constructively where appropriate and build support for improvement and change. You will support innovation, service development and demand management through initiatives such as training, guidance, templates, self-service resources and new ways of working.

This varied role combines stakeholder engagement, performance improvement, project leadership and strategic problem-solving. It offers a unique opportunity for someone with legal knowledge and strong analytical skills to influence how legal services are delivered without returning to a traditional fee-earning or case management role.

Whether your background is as a lawyer looking to step away from frontline legal practice, or in legal services, governance, transformation, insight & data, business partnering, performance management or operational leadership, you will have the ability to turn complex information into practical insight, build credibility with senior stakeholders and help create a modern, resilient and forward-thinking Legal Service
